Popcorn [Zea mays (L.) var. Everta] is an important field crop in the Midwestern United States. However, hailstorms are a major threat to ensuring high yield because of their effects on leaf photosynthesis, pollination, and stalk lodging. Abstract Pennycress ( Thlaspi arvense L.) is an emerging bioenergy oilseed crop of interest to farmers in the Upper Midwestern United States. Improved lines with beneficial agronomic traits are being developed, including reduced silicle shattering and altered seed coat characteristics, though planting establishment still challenging for this small‐seeded crop.
